Abstract

The results of the study of reproductive qualities of purebred sows of the Large White breed, as well as crossbred sows of the combination ♀ the Large White × ♂ Landras (LW × L) with terminal boars (T) and other paternal forms – boars of the breed Landras (L) and Pietren are presented. The main purpose of the work done is to compare the terminal boars of own reproduction (T) obtained from the combination of breeds ♂ [♀ (♀LW × ♂L) × ♂P], with pure-breed boars of the Landras and Pietran breeds. The work was carried out in the conditions of the farm “SviatoNikolske” of the Krynychansky district of Dnipropetrovsk region. Seven experimental groups were formed for the experiment: I – LW × LW, II – LW × L, III – (LW × L) × L, IV – LW × P, V – (LW × L) × P, VI – LW × T, VII – (LW × L) × T. According to the main index of reproductive qualities – multiplicity, a significant difference was determined between groups I and IV – in favor of a purebred combination of KB × KB (p ≤ 0.01). The combination of (LW × L) × T (VII group) was the best among all the experimental groups, where a significant difference was found with respect to the control group (p ≤ 0.05; p ≤ 0.001) for all reproductive characteristics. Other combinations in terms of reproductive qualities were almost indistinguishable from the control group. Within each experimental group, the level of variability of the traits of reproductive qualities (Cv,%) was determined. A low level of variability (Cvmax = 9.1 %) was determined, which indicates the selection of productivity features. A comprehensive evaluation of each test group, based on reproductive qualities, was determined by the value of the evaluation indices. In addition to sow productivity, the most convenient indices for practical work were also identified. All six indexes used have a high level of correlation (from 0.78 ± 0.210; p ≤ 0.001 to 0.997 ± 0.0271; p ≤ 0.001), and the least labor and time costs are demanded by the indexes of Berezovsky M.D. and Shatalina Yu.D. One-factor ANOVA revealed a sufficiently high influence of the origin factor (η² from 32.58 ± 0.064 to 53.17 ± 0.045; p ≤ 0.001). That is, in the hybridization system, great attention must be paid to the level of productivity of the original maternal and paternal forms.

Key words: pig breeding, selection, terminal boar, reproductive qualities, crossing.
